Limited vinyl LP repressing. Love for Sale is the second studio album by Euro-Caribbean group Boney M. The album includes the hits "Ma Baker" (#96 on the Billboard Hot 100, #31 on the Club Play Singles chart), and "Belfast". It also includes covers: "Love for Sale" (by Cole Porter), "Have You Ever Seen the Rain?" (by Creedence Clearwater Revival), and "Still I'm Sad" (by The Yardbirds).

Euro Disco Perfection
BoneyM’s second studio album, “Love For Sale”, released in 1977, was a worthy follow up to their debut album “Take The Heat Off Me”. Continuing with the Euro Disco theme, pulsating hard driving rhythms and solid singing by Liz Mitchell, “Love For Sale” hits all the right notes. The album greatly benefits from being released at Disco’s commercial peak but the material here is solid. “Ma Baker” and the title track are memorable sing along Disco nuggets, as are “Plantation Boy” and “Motherless Child”. International hits “Belfast” and “Silent Lover” are harder hitting Disco numbers that lit up dance floors at Discos across Europe. “Have You Ever Seen The Rain” and “Gloria Can You Waddle” have twinges of reggae in their beat and “Still I’m Sad” is the album’s lone ballad and it’s a beauty. No filler at all on this album, each song is a vital slice of Euro Dance Pop and the music has not aged at all, even if the material is very much a product of its place and time.There are also two Bonus tracks here. A re-mix of “Ma Baker” and the previously unreleased track called “Stories”.The sound on this EU made re-master is amazing, and the original album cover art front and back is preserved. A must have for Disco collectors.
